How sad that yet another business in Blatchington Road, Hove, is closing down (The Argus, May 15).
Lyon's Textile curtain shop is closing due to retirement and Vokins is also having a closing down sale.
What is happening to a oncevibrant main shopping area? I remember little grocery shops, a book shop, a pie shop, shoeshops, butchers and a mens outfitter's which had a pole in the centre of its doorway which was fun to spin round. The road is dying due to the greed of the parking situation.
- P Twiselton, The Drive, Hove
